Transaction 037cf5ca714cb2414385539330c281dc96bb70547d71479fe3e2d7a1b4de0b42
2 Input
2 Outputs
- 037cf5ca714cb2414385539330c281dc96bb70547d71479fe3e2d7a1b4de0b42:0
- 037cf5ca714cb2414385539330c281dc96bb70547d71479fe3e2d7a1b4de0b42:1
value 80000000
address 1DWxysF7GPRYGShNxL5ux2N2JLRa9rbE6k
value 12999952882
address 12kDGhXMnnGpXedeQWkukc3Dq2yFxYHLx4